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/logging/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java log4j和Logging Util类之间的性能和功能差异_Java_Logging_Log4j_Error Logging_Java.util.logging - Fatal编程技术网

Java log4j和Logging Util类之间的性能和功能差异

Java log4j和Logging Util类之间的性能和功能差异,java,logging,log4j,error-logging,java.util.logging,Java,Logging,Log4j,Error Logging,Java.util.logging,我是Java.util包中日志类的新手,我已经开发了一个应用程序,希望在不同的级别实现日志机制,我只是在考虑选择哪一个,并确定这两个版本之间的差异。 我在找 1) 记录器应该易于维护和实现。 任何人都可以对此提出建议。java.util.logging是一个糟糕的API,再加上糟糕的实现。Log4j在所有可测量的方面都更好 但是,如果这是一个新的开发,那么就有比log4j更好的api,比如,和更好的日志实现,比如。我想试试那些。Log4j已经有点过时了,但它是完全可用的。java.util.lo

我是Java.util包中日志类的新手,我已经开发了一个应用程序,希望在不同的级别实现日志机制,我只是在考虑选择哪一个,并确定这两个版本之间的差异。 我在找 1) 记录器应该易于维护和实现。
任何人都可以对此提出建议。

java.util.logging
是一个糟糕的API,再加上糟糕的实现。Log4j在所有可测量的方面都更好


但是,如果这是一个新的开发,那么就有比log4j更好的api,比如,和更好的日志实现,比如。我想试试那些。Log4j已经有点过时了,但它是完全可用的。

java.util.logging
是一个糟糕的API,而且实现也很糟糕。Log4j在所有可测量的方面都更好


但是,如果这是一个新的开发,那么就有比log4j更好的api,比如,和更好的日志实现,比如。我想试试那些。Log4j已经有点长了,但它是完全可用的。

SLF4J实际上是一个日志外观,因此可以在不同的日志实现(例如util日志、Log4j、logback等)之间切换,而无需修改代码。是的,这就是为什么我称它为API:)SLF4J实际上是一个日志外观,因此可以在不同的日志实现(例如,util日志、log4j、logback等)之间切换,而无需修改代码。是的,这就是为什么我称它为API:)